ARLINGTON BREAKS IN STADIUM FOR LEE

AUGUST 31, 2002
MIDLAND
, TX -- Arlington High quarterback Joe Jon Finley ran wild in Midland Lee's new stadium, running for three touchdowns, throwing for another and racking up nearly 300 yards in total offense during the Colts' 37-7 victory over the Rebels.

From the moment Finley hit Brad Ekwerekwu for 54 yards and the game's first score, it became evident he was the best player on the stadium's Astroplay turf. For those who needed more convincing, Finley added touchdown runs of 52, 82 and 9 yards.  On the night, the Arlington High team accumulated 394 yards of total offense.  The Rebels totaled 273 yards. On the ground, Lee rushed the ball 40 times for 176 yards.  Quarterback Cameron Phillips was 10 of 23 for 97 yards. He also threw three interceptions.
